According to the latest Crop Progress report from USDA, some 90% of corn was reported emerged, above both the 87% emerged last year and the 81% emerged in the week prior. The 5-year average emergence rate for this week was 82%.
Some 58% of corn crops were reported in "good" condition, with another 14% in "excellent" condition and 23% in "fair condition."
USDA also reported 90% of soybeans have been planted, an increase from the 84% planted by this point last year. This also surpasses the 79% 5-year average.
According to the report, 76% of soybeans have emerged, above the 65% reported emerged in the same week last year. The 5-year average for soybean emergence in this week was 59%.
Some 57% of corn crops were reported in "good" condition, with another 10% in "excellent" condition and 27% in "fair condition."
